Human Resource Business Partner-Support Services(Britam)



Human Resource Business Partner-Support Services
Reporting to the Group Human Resource Manager, the HR Business Partner  will be responsible for the planning, directing and coordinating Human Resource Management activities for support departments (ICT, Internal Audit, Risk, Legal, HR, Group Finance, Administration, Marketing and Procurement) at Britam. This role will also serve as the HRBP for Project Jawabu SPOCs. 
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Plans, directs, supervises and interprets human resources policies and procedures for support departments.
  • Advises on day to day employee relation issues and on programs for involvement, team building, empowerment and communication. Also responsible for other HR activities like equal employment opportunity, disciplinary procedures, dress code, sexual harassment and discrimination.
  • In liaison with the respective support leaders and Group HR Manager, prepare forecasts of Human Resources requirements and plans.  
  • Administer staff recruitment and orientation process for the various support functions.
  • Plans and conducts new employee orientation to foster positive attitude toward organizational objectives.
  • Ingrain the performance management culture by embedding the balanced scorecard and ensuring manager and staff understanding of the performance process to effectively link compensation and reward to performance.
  • Identify training needs, participate in development of programmes and schedules and oversee execution as well as analyze application of training and return of investment to the business.
  • Prepare employee separation notices and related documentation and conduct exit interviews to determine reasons behind separation.
  • Implement Human Resources policies and procedures that guide business operations 
  • Administers staff benefit schemes, including Group Medical, Personal Accident Group Pension and Group life insurance schemes.
  • Ensures the maintenance of up-to-date staff records and files 
  • Prepare monthly reports


KEY QUALIFICATIONS, KNOWLEDGE AND EXPERIENCE
  • Bachelors degree in Business, Human Resources or related discipline
  • Diploma in HR Management, Organizational Development or related areas
  • A minimum of 5 years’ progressive experience in human resources management 
  • Good team player with excellent organizational, planning and multitasking skills
  • Highly developed MS Office proficiency 

COMPETENCIES AND REQUIREMENTS
  • Strong work ethic as well as the maturity and confidence to deal professionally and sociably with management, staff at all levels and external parties
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ills 
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ality on personal and company matters.
  • Results oriented with ability to work under strict deadlines
  • Proactive approach to problem identification and resolution
  • Ability to manage conflicting priorities and deliver work of high quality

KEY PERFORMANCE STANDARDS & AREAS
  • Staff engagement as evidenced by employee productivity, employee turnover, satisfaction index and other relevant data / statistics.
  • Annual staff appraisals and salary reviews completed on time
  • HR and support services expenditure, maintained within approved budgets
  • Training programmes undertaken as scheduled
  • Harmonious industrial / employee relations maintained
  • Effective delivery of HR consultancy services
  • HR analytics and reporting
  • Optimal staffing levels
